Definition

"Silybum marianum" is the scientific name for milk thistle, a plant with distinctive white-veined leaves and purple flowers. This is the name used by scientists and botanists to avoid any confusion caused by common names. Unlike common names, scientific names are standardized and recognized worldwide. Etymology

"Silybum" is derived from the Greek word "silybos", referring to a type of thistle. "Marianum" refers to the Virgin Mary. Legend says that the white veins on the leaves appeared when a drop of the Virgin Mary's milk fell on them. This etymology connects the plant to religious and cultural significance.
